Lately, i have been making my own jigs and now I want to start making swimbaits.  Does anyone know how I would cut PVC foam for swimbaits between eight and twelve inches.  Also, do any of you guys know how heavy and hard to ballast PVC is compared to balsa?  Thanks.

I use PVC from the trim section at Lowes but a lot of other home centers have it. It will cut and carve with standard woodworking tools very well. A few things that make PVC a good choice for baits is it will not absorb water(no need to use a sealer), there is no grain to deal with so drilling straight holes is easier( no grain to follow), holds screw eyes or twisted stainless hardware very well and it floats.

As far as weighting it is similar to poplar but unlike wood the density does not vary with each piece so once you have your weighting figured out it will remain the same from bait to bait. PM me if you have any more questions.
